| Applications |
Compétences requises |
| Développement de cartes "banc de test" pour prototypage de circuits intégrés |
Mise en oeuvre des FPGA de dernière génération de la famille Virtex 4 de Xilinx |
| Carte d'asservissement multi-axes de moteurs pas à pas |
Utilisation du bus CAN
Développement complet d'algorithmes d'asservissement en boucle fermée de contrôle de moteurs pas à pas dans un FPGA (Altera Cyclone) |
| Ordinateurs industriels complets utilisés dans le contrôle de processus industriels |
Mise en oeuvre de processeurs Motorola 680x0
Architecture à base de bus cPCI, VME, G96
Implantation d'OS temps réels
Normes CE |
| Gestion d'entrées-sorties sur bus de terrain |
Mise en oeuvre de FIP, CAN, Profibus, ModBus
Interfaces digitales et analogiques diverses et variées
Ecriture de drivers sous de nombreux OS (Windows, Linux, OS9, VxWorks,...) |
| Machine spéciales de production industrielle |
Nombreuses cartes CPU à base d'architecture x86 et Pentium (PC industriels)
Implantation de BIOS et de systèmes d'exploitation (Windows, VxWorks, MS-DOS, Linux)
Architectures au bus PCI, cPCI, VME, G96
Nécessité d'une grande robustesse, d'un taux de panne très faible et d'un support très réactif |
| Testeur de production pour circuit intégré de carte à puces |
Grande fiabilité
Algorithme complexe implanté dans un FPGA
Excitation de circuit RF complexe
Mesure de très faible courant ayant une grande tension de mode commun
Firmware implantant la norme ISO 7816
Interface Homme-Machine
Intégration mécanique complète (armoire électrique) |
| Carte de commande de robot "pick and place" |
Mise en oeuvre du PowerPC555
Grande fiabilité |
| Carte de contrôle et d'asservissement de moteurs électriques |
Carte à base de DSP 56K de Motorola
Software de haut niveau permettant de gérer des mouvements complexes sur 4 axes simultanément |
| Appareil d'étalonnage de température |
Développement d'interfaces spécifiques pour thermocouples J, K, T, R et S
Software complet d'interface Homme-Machine |
| Test final de qualification de production pour circuits intégrés "grand public" |
Mise en oeuvre de microcontrôleur 16 bits
Fiabilité de l'interface
Implantation d'algorithme temps réels dans FPGA (Xilinx Virtex II et/ou ALTERA Stratix)
USB 2.0
Acquisition analogique 14 bits, 54MHz |
| Appareil de calibrage et banc de test optique pour un fabricant de fibre optique |
Mise en oeuvre d'entrées-sorties sur le bus USB
Intégration mécanique
Utilisation "continue", nécessité d'une grande réactivité de notre part en cas de maintenance |
| Calculateurs pour centre de calcul scientifique |
Connexion en réseau (Ethernet 100 Mbits/s)
Mise en oeuvre d'une plate-forme de type PC |
| Test "Burn-in" longue durée pour qualification de nouveaux circuits intégrés |
Contraintes climatiques sévères (cartes soumises à des températures supérieure à 100 °C)
Mise en oeuvre du bus USB et Ethernet (Firmware et hardware)
Interface Homme-Machine |
 |
 |